ChazzBazz2020 ...As I'm sure a large number of PC players have noticed, Skyrim doesn't have a built in option to change your FOV. The default is very narrow, and I've heard many people (and myself) complain that the small FOV can cause motion sickness, or cause difficulty in keeping your bearings during combat, especially with several enemies.

Oct 29, 2016 · 4. Start the game and open the Character Menu in game (Tab by default) this will adjust to FoV to 90. What the values do: fDefaultFOV=75. Affects the zoom level of the lock when lockpicking and the items in the inventory screen. (Change it to a higher value if you want it to look smaller) fDefault1stPersonFOV=75.

For those that don't know how to change fov click the tilde button(§) and type fov 'number' noname278 11 years ago #2. 90 is what ya want.Skyrim uses the traditional hFOV (horizontal FOV), while some games, particularly those in the Battlefield series, are using vFOV (vertical FOV). The theoretical appropriate hFOVs for common aspect ratios are 106.26 for 16:9, 100.39 for 16:10, 90 for 4:3, and 86.3 for 5:4, but the vast majority of people posting about what FOVs they actually ...FOV-Tangent Multiplier. The FOV-tangent multiplier setting allows you to adjust the horizontal and vertical rendering field of view. By reducing the default values (1.0), you will lose visibility on the edges of your screen while potentially making significant gains in the overall performance. ... Open SkyrimPrefs.ini, and search for [General] section. Add fdefaultfov=XX at the end of the section. (where XX is the FOV value you want to change to). For example add fdefaultfov=90. Open Skyrim.ini, and search for [Display] section. Add fDefaultWorldFOV=XX (where XX is the FOV value you put in fdefaultfov) Once you have opened the console window, you can type fov X where X is a number between 0 and 180. This will change your FOV to the desired value. You can also use the command fov reset to reset your FOV back to its default value. In-Game Options. To change the default FOV, find the Skyrim.ini file in your Documents\My Games\Skyrim\ folder and place the following line under the [Display] settings header: fDefaultWorldFOV=x.x where x.x is the number of degrees you'd like to set it for. Posted November 20, 2022. FOV is among the information that gets coded into your save file, and INI changes to it are only visible upon starting a new character. In order to change fov on an existing save, you have to use the FOV console command.
